Borussia Mönchengladbach are pursuing different plans with their midfield trio Oscar Fraulo (19), Conor Noss (22) and Torben Müsel (23). The former, who switched from FC Midtjylland to Borussia in the summer for a fee of two million euros, will end the season with the foals. “We knew he needed a bit of time. It is important for him to be involved in the training process. Every unit at this level takes him further. It’s a bit early to be thinking about a loan.”coach Daniel Farke told the ‘Rheinische Post’.

The situation is different for Noss and Müsel. Farke on possible loan transfers: “We are in talks there, but these will only be decisions that make sense for all sides. You’ll see what happens by the end of the transfer period.” Both young professionals are at home in attacking midfield, part of the professional squad, but with little prospect of playing time.
